Foundations of Physics

Physics is often called the “fundamental science” because it seeks to explain the basic laws that govern the universe. From the motion of planets and falling apples, to the energy powering our homes and the light that allows us to see—physics is at the heart of it all.

In this course, Foundations of Physics, you’ll begin your journey into understanding how the world works at its most essential level. We’ll start with the basics: what physics is, the scientific method, and why measurement and precision matter. Then, step by step, you’ll explore motion, forces, energy, electricity, waves, sound, and light—core topics that build the groundwork for more advanced studies.

By the end of this course, you won’t just know definitions and formulas—you’ll see how physics connects to your daily life, from the technology you use to the natural world around you. This foundation will prepare you for deeper learning in science, engineering, medicine, and beyond.

So, get ready to ask questions, explore patterns, and uncover the principles that shape our universe. Welcome to the Foundations of Physics!
